Authorize transfers and other necessary measure to implement HB 2 section A
This bill amends Montana Code Annotated section 2-15-1808 to implement requirements from House Bill 2. It directs the Board of Investments (within Montana's Department of Commerce) to operate under a "restricted fiduciary fund type" as specified in law. The amendment clarifies the Board's composition, including nine governor-appointed members (with specific representation requirements) and two nonvoting legislative liaisons from opposing parties. The changes take effect July 1, 2025.
